In the historic move that indicators a change in labor relations throughout the gaming marketplace, practically 200 builders from Blizzard Enjoyment’s Overwatch two team have correctly unionized. This marks the second significant unionization exertion at Blizzard, pursuing the unionization from the World of Warcraft group in 2024. The new union, called the Overwatch Gamemakers Guild, was formed underneath the umbrella from the Communications Employees of America (CWA) and reflects a rising development of employee solidarity inside an market which has extensive been noted for its tough operate disorders and a record of resistance to unionization.

The Catalyst for Improve: Layoffs, Crunch Time, and Shell out Inequities
The drive for unionization throughout the Overwatch 2 team was fueled by various components, most notably a series of mass layoffs along with the pervasive tradition of "crunch" time That always forces personnel to work too much several hours to satisfy tight deadlines. In January 2024, Microsoft, which had obtained Activision Blizzard inside a $69 billion deal, laid off just about one,900 staff throughout its gaming division. Blizzard was significantly influenced, and many of the Overwatch 2 staff members have been remaining grappling with work insecurity, mounting tension, and a lack of adequate severance.

Besides fears about position stability, employees voiced their aggravation with pay out disparities and inadequate Advantages. Numerous team members felt that their hard work on a higher-profile title like Overwatch 2 wasn't staying compensated quite as compared to comparable roles at other studios. The issues of reduced wages, extensive Performing hours, and deficiency of appropriate recognition for his or her contributions led to rising dissatisfaction within the staff.

A Broadly Supported Motion
The unionization energy quickly received traction One of the Overwatch two team, with staff members from all departments—artists, designers, engineers, and high quality assurance testers—coming alongside one another to sort a unified entrance. The unionization course of action was performed by way of a neutral third-social gathering arbitrator who verified that a the vast majority of the team supported the move. The CWA, that has been within the forefront of labor Arranging from the tech and gaming sectors, provided the mandatory assistance and assistance all over the system.

One key Think about the achievements of the unionization hard work was Microsoft’s 2022 labor neutrality arrangement While using the CWA. This arrangement ensures that Microsoft, given that the guardian organization of Blizzard, wouldn't interfere With all the staff’ correct to prepare. This performed a crucial purpose in permitting the Overwatch 2 workforce to unionize with no dealing with resistance from management, which is generally the situation in industries that are usually hostile to unions.

What’s Next: Agreement Negotiations and Long run Implications
The Overwatch Gamemakers Guild is now coming into the subsequent period of its journey—agreement negotiations. The union is aiming to secure fair wages, better Advantages, enhanced career protection, and protections in opposition to the anxiety-inducing "crunch" periods which have very long been a hallmark of game development. While the highway to a formal contract would require negotiation, the union hopes that it's going to bring about a far more balanced and sustainable work environment for builders.

The formation of your Overwatch two group’s union is a robust statement in the broader gaming industry, which has witnessed a gradual but regular rise in unionization initiatives. In addition to Blizzard, studios for example ZeniMax and Bethesda have found productive unionization initiatives lately. The success from the Overwatch 2 group could serve as a model for other video game builders wanting to secure much better circumstances for on their own.
